Transaction 209af81b8639c340ee903e40a95091417a7ed7d5e20f3517b065c716145b2bfa
1 Input
2 Outputs
- 209af81b8639c340ee903e40a95091417a7ed7d5e20f3517b065c716145b2bfa:0
- 209af81b8639c340ee903e40a95091417a7ed7d5e20f3517b065c716145b2bfa:1
value 30444470
address 1PU773M9cSZQMrjenfmEUKbCMPhC7TMAex
value 34502687
address 12eU8rhYdD59WuPMban5VzXa1kANhZE7XQ